Securing Financing

There are several ways to fund your business. One of the first things you need to do is set up a budget. This will help you understand how much money you need to get started and how much you need to operate month to month. Once you have a budget, you can explore different ways to raise funds, such as small business loans, crowdfunding, and grants. Remember that securing financing is not just about getting the money you need but also about creating a strong foundation for your business to thrive. With a solid budget and some creative fundraising strategies, you’ll be well on your way to achieving your goals.

Developing a Marketing Plan

Every business, especially a startup, needs a marketing plan to reach its target customers. The first step is to identify your target audience and understand their behavior and needs. Once you have a clear understanding, you can create a plan that speaks directly to them. This involves deciding on the channels you want to use, such as social media, email, or print advertising. Your message should be consistent across all channels and resonate with your target audience. Remember, your marketing plan needs to be flexible and adaptable as the market evolves, so don’t be afraid to tweak it along the way. With a solid marketing plan in place, you’ll be well on your way to attracting and retaining your ideal customers.

Finding the Right Location

Choosing the right office or shop space can mean the difference between success and failure. Finding the perfect location that meets your needs and is strategically situated for your market can be challenging. But with patience, research, and a well-thought-out plan, you can find the right space that will allow your business to thrive. It’s important to consider factors such as accessibility, visibility, foot traffic, and competition when making this decision. Once you find the ideal spot, you’ll be well on your way to establishing yourself in your industry and achieving your business goals.
